Modules List

Started by markcwm, June 13, 2017, 01:52:42

Previous topic - Next topic

markcwm

I thought I'd repost my modules/apps list here to help get things going. This version allows you to browse by category.
Thanks for making this a sticky Qube. Additions and corrections are most welcome.

Module Collections
2d Frameworks
2d Drivers
3d Engines
2d Audio
3d Audio
Particles
3d Libraries
3d Physics
GUI
GUI Builders
GUI Gadgets
GUI Drivers
Networking
Database
File Formats
Controllers
Open Source Games
Applications
IDEs

markcwm

#1
Module Collections

Alberto-Diablo modules - scriptlua, script, audiosquall, audio, collision, reflector, language, random
Repo: http://code.google.com/p/apimax/

Axe3d modules - axe3d, b3d, b3dsdk, drivers, m3d, minib3d, model, ode
Axe modules - entityport, freeport, gif, jasper, oggsaver, pixmapgraphics, portaudio, python, v8, wiimote
https://github.com/nitrologic

BaH modules - appstub, avbin, barcode, base64, bass, bigint, boost, box2d, cairo, cegui, chipmunk, clearsilver, crypto, curses, database, datetime, dbgp, dbmysql, dbodbc, dboracle, dbpostgresql, dbsqlite, dbxbase, diff, escapi, expat, filesystemex, fit, flickcurl, fmod, format, freeimage, freetypegl, ftpparser, gdal, glslopt, gme, gmp, graphviz, growl, gtkmaxgui, gtkwebkitgtk, inet, interprocess, irrklang, jansson, keychain, leptonica, libarchive, libcurl, libiconv, libnotify, libsmbclient, libssh2, libtcod, libtorrent, libusb, libwebsockets, libxml, libxslt, locale, magick, mapm, mathtoolkit, maxguitextareascintilla, maxunit, muparser, oggvorbis, opencl, osmesa, persistence, protobuf, qrencode, raknet, ramsstream, random, raptor, rational, regex, registry, rtl, rtmidi, scriptingbridge, serial, sfxr, sid, sparkle, speech, sstream, streamhtmlparser, stringbuffer, taglib, tesseract, textsstream, theoraplayer, tmx, unimotion, uuid, volumes, wiringpi, xcb, xls, xlwriter, xz
Topic: http://mojolabs.nz/posts.php?topic=75695
Site: http://brucey.net/programming/blitz/index.php
Repo: https://github.com/maxmods/bah.mod

BlitzMax Next Generation - bcc, bmk, pub, brl, maxgui, axe, sdl, b3d, zeke, bgfx
Site: http://www.blitzmax.org/
Repo: https://github.com/bmx-ng

BlitzMax modules mirror - axe, bah, wx, dwlab, maxgui, sidesign, osgplugins, osg, axe3d, byo, muttley, rigz
Repo: http://github.com/BlitzMaxModules

Chaos Interactive modules (by d-bug, Hyde and hamZta) - CocoaUserDefaults, ChaosClone, ChaosConsole, ChaosButton, DesktopExtension, BitmapFont, Ini
Site: http://www.chaos-interactive.de/en/modules

Duct-Max game modules - animations, app, appendstream, archive, arghandling, argparser, clapp, csv, drawstate, dui, duidate, duidraw, duimisc, enumerator, etc, graphix, imageio, ini, input, intmap, json, locale, logging, memcrypt, network, numericmap, objectio, objectmap, pathing, protog2d, rc4, reflectivenetwork, scriptparser, soundmap, tilemap, time, variables, vector
Repo: https://github.com/komiga/duct-max
Site: http://www.komiga.com/?q=node/14

GMan modules & stuff - Irrlicht, Xeffects, Addons, ColDet, 3Impact, SIDPlay, SIDSample, SIDStream, ISQLDB, ZipEngine, Mappy, PCXLoader, ggTray
Site: http://www.gprogs.com

Htbaa modules - zmq, rest, rackspacecloudfiles, xmlrpc, sqlbuilder, process, goal, fuzzy, fsm, factory
Repo: http://github.com/Htbaa

ITSpeedway modules - maxgui.stylesheet, bhtree, printing, vectorfont, win32service
Repo: https://sourceforge.net/u/itspeedway/profile/

JazzieB examples - Bitmap Fonts, User Input, Scrolling, Invaders
Site: http://www.blitz.sos-software.co.uk/code.htm

Kistjes modules - Phidget21, Sprite, Modelshop, Animation
Repo: http://code.google.com/p/blitzmax-modules

kfprimm modules - maxb3d, maxb3dex, prime, gfx, mapletce, nehe_bmx
Maxb3d modules - a3dsloader, audio3d, b3dcollision, b3dloader, boneanimator, bsploader, core, d3d11driver, d3d9driver, drivers, functions, gldriver, glsloader, gui, heightmaploader, loaders, logging, math, md2loader, ms3dloader, newton, objloader, openalaudio3d, plyloader, primitives, retro, stringfunctionloader, vertexanimator, xloader
Prime modules - aamva, app, archive, assetmanager, assetpacker, blockpacker, bsp, csv, deltatimer, enumerator, kbsplines, lib3ds, libb3d, libgls, libms3d, libply, libx, math3d, max2dasset, maxml, newton, npapi, pcxloader, pixmapasset, pixmapex, pixmappacker, printlib, pthreads2, serialio, triangulator, xmlasset
Gfx modules - cgshaderdriver, cgtoolkit, d3d11max2d, d3d11max2dex, d3d9max2dex, directxex, dxgraphicsex, glmax2dex, max2dex
Repo: http://github.com/kfprimm

Lobby modules - arraylist, beziercurve, body, clipboard, content, datafile, fastrandom, filemanipulator, freepolledinput, inifile, line2d, multitouch, object2d, polygon, primenumber, touchgui, touchobject, vector, wavearea, wndproccallback
Download: http://www.blitzforum.de/forum/viewtopic.php?t=34549

Muttley modules - commandstack, stack, logger, inifilehandler, SublimeText, node-os-service, registry
Repo: https://bitbucket.org/muttley/
Mirror: http://code.google.com/p/muttmod/

Nilium modules - lugi, tmbundle, bmxlexer, NUIToolkit, bufferedglmax2d, renderbuffer, jonk, charset, numerical
Repo: http://github.com/nilium

Otus modules - RE2, ZlibStream, LzmaStream, FS, Actor, Lzma
Repo: https://code.google.com/p/otus-mod/

PantsOn modules - MPEG, Morph, REKO, Theora, YUV
Site: http://www.pantson.com/mods

Perturbatio modules - appfuncs, cgi, html, stringlist
Mirror: http://mojolabs.nz/userlog.php?user=8652&log=1737

Spacerat modules - advtext, colour, logprintstream, riff, snarl, threadedio, tiles
Repo: http://github.com/Spacerat/joe.mod

Vertex's modules - BNetEx, DreiDe engine, MIDI, OpenAL, MySQL, Milkshape3D Loader, BSP-Compiler, Raycaster Engine
Site: http://vertex.dreamfall.at/projects.php
Repo: https://github.com/oliverskawronek

Warpy's code and games
Repo: http://github.com/christianp/warpycode

Wiebo's modules - game2d, grid2d, vector2d, propertygrid, quadtree, artemax
Repo: https://github.com/wiebow

Yasha's projects - ybc, BlitzMax-Extensions, MaxYourselfASchemeIn48Hours, TMeta-Parser, MaxBridge
Repo: http://github.com/Leushenko

markcwm

#2
2d Frameworks

RetroRemakes Framework
Repo: http://code.google.com/p/retroremakes-framework

Planiax 2D Framework
Topic: http://mojolabs.nz/posts.php?topic=88042
Site: http://www.playniax.com

Dig - 2d game and app framework
Repo: http://github.com/GWRon

Digital Wizard's Lab framework
Repo: http://code.google.com/p/dwlab/

BMax 2D Framework
Topic: http://mojolabs.nz/posts.php?topic=83888
Repo: http://code.google.com/p/bmax2dframework

Public Domain part of Grey Alien Framework
Topic: http://mojolabs.nz/posts.php?topic=82765

OFXMax - OpenFrameworks
Topic: http://mojolabs.nz/posts.php?topic=84991
Repo: http://code.google.com/p/ofxmax

Horizon - Rapid game prototyping framework (by maverick69)
Repo: https://github.com/JochenHeizmann/Horizon

markcwm



markcwm

#5

markcwm

#6


markcwm

#8
GUI Builders

Logic Gui Professional
Toolbox: http://web.archive.org/web/20160619072958/http://www.blitzbasic.com/toolbox/toolbox.php?tool=182
Site: http://jsp.logiczone.de

GUIde
Toolbox: http://web.archive.org/web/20160619052400/http://www.blitzbasic.com/toolbox/toolbox.php?tool=28
Repo: https://github.com/wiebow/guide


GUI Gadgets

Scintilla - TextArea replacement (Win)
Topic: http://mojolabs.nz/posts.php?topic=85716
Repo: http://code.google.com/p/scintillabmx

maxguitextareascintilla.mod - Scintilla textarea (Linux/Mac)
Repo: https://github.com/maxmods/bah.mod


GUI Drivers

gtkmaxgui.mod - GTK driver for MaxGUI
Repo: https://github.com/maxmods/bah.mod

QtMax - unfinished
Repo: http://code.google.com/p/qtmax

markcwm


markcwm

#10

markcwm

#11
File Formats

MaXML - XML module
Topic: http://mojolabs.nz/posts.php?topic=53834
Download: http://mojolabs.nz/userlog.php?user=8652&log=1737

ZipStream module
Topic: http://mojolabs.nz/posts.php?topic=71734
Repo: https://github.com/maxmods/koriolis.mod

Batch Renamer
Repo: http://code.google.com/p/batch-renamer

Reflection-Based JSON Encoder/Decoder
Repo: https://github.com/Trylobot/bmx-rjson

Dependency injection module - uses Reflection
Repo: https://github.com/FWeinb/injection.mod

ParserGen and Coocoo - parser/compiler generators
Topic: http://mojolabs.nz/posts.php?topic=66735
Site: http://sites.google.com/site/grable0

Blitz Lua
Topic: http://mojolabs.nz/posts.php?topic=68845
Wiki: http://lua-users.org/wiki/BlitzLua

BlitzProg Precompiler
Repo: http://code.google.com/p/bb-bmax-precompiler

HOTDOCS - html generator
Toolbox: http://web.archive.org/web/20160618193050/http://www.blitzbasic.com/toolbox/toolbox.php?tool=142
Site: http://www.hotdocs.de.vu

markcwm

#12
Controllers

FryPad - virtual control system for game input
Topic: http://mojolabs.nz/posts.php?topic=85744
Download: http://www.hi-toro.com/blitz/frypad.rar

Multitouch module
Topic: http://www.blitzforum.de/forum/viewtopic.php?p=365769#365769
Download: http://www.flowersoft.smokecover.com/flowersoft/developement/lobby%20modules.rar

ManyMouse wrapper
Topic: http://mojolabs.nz/posts.php?topic=77031

Linux Webcam wrapper
Topic: http://mojolabs.nz/posts.php?topic=55972
Download: http://mojolabs.nz/userlog.php?user=8652&log=1737

ESCAPI Webcam DLL - Extremely Simple Capture API
Code: http://mojolabs.nz/codearcs.php?code=1899
Site: http://sol.gfxile.net/code.html

Open Source Games

Cocoon - Tandy Color Computer emulator
Repo: https://github.com/laurentmor/cocoon-bm

Vib'Z - shoot-em-up
Repo: http://code.google.com/p/pfe-blitzmax

Arky - Revolution remake
Repo: http://code.google.com/p/arky

MaxGames - VectorTube and VectorZone
Repo: http://code.google.com/p/maxgames

markcwm

#13
Applications

Framework Assistant - template generator
Topic: http://mojolabs.nz/posts.php?topic=47141
Repo: http://sites.google.com/site/jimbrown007/

BlitzMax Companion - download manager
Topic: http://mojolabs.nz/posts.php?topic=79814
Site: http://www.graphio.net

Maximus - module manager
Site: https://github.com/maximos

Blitz Code Archives - code downloader
Topic: http://blitzmax.com/Community/posts.php?topic=88368

Fontext - bitmap font tool
Topic: http://mojolabs.nz/posts.php?topic=65909

Font Machine - bitmap font tool
Toolbox: http://web.archive.org/web/20160619092430/http://www.blitzbasic.com/toolbox/toolbox.php?tool=214
Site: http://www.blide.org

Universal Map Editor - 2d tilemap editor
Topic: http://www.blitzforum.de/forum/viewtopic.php?t=19899
Site: http://mapeditor.de.vu

IsoBlox - isometric pixel art tool
Repo: https://github.com/Trylobot/isoblox

BlitzICON - icon and manifest tool (Win)
Topic: http://mojolabs.nz/posts.php?topic=86283

MakeObject - icon tool (Win)
Topic: http://mojolabs.nz/posts.php?topic=66129
Download: https://sites.google.com/site/yanbloke/MakeObject.zip

markcwm

#14
IDEs

BLIde
Toolbox: http://web.archive.org/web/20160619071115/http://www.blitzbasic.com/toolbox/toolbox.php?tool=131
Site: http://www.blide.org

MaxIDE - default IDE v1.43/1.44
Topic: http://mojolabs.nz/posts.php?topic=102086
Repo: https://github.com/nitrologic/maxide
Repo: http://sourceforge.net/projects/maxgui/files/

MaxIDE Community Edition
Toolbox: http://web.archive.org/web/20160619031248/http://www.blitzbasic.com/toolbox/toolbox.php?tool=164
Repo: http://blitzmax-ide.sourceforge.net/

MaxEdit - steamstub, maxedit
Topic: http://mojolabs.nz/posts.php?topic=53227
Repo: http://code.google.com/p/max-edit

HydraMax IDE
Toolbox: http://web.archive.org/web/20160619092241/http://www.blitzbasic.com/toolbox/toolbox.php?tool=192
Site: http://www.eiksoft.com/hydra

CollIDE - MaxIDE in Java
Toolbox: http://web.archive.org/web/20160619092230/http://www.blitzbasic.com/toolbox/toolbox.php?tool=244
Repo: http://code.google.com/p/blitzcoderide

EclipseMax - editor for Eclipse
Repo: http://code.google.com/p/eclipsemax

indevIDE - full-featured open source IDE
Topic: http://mojolabs.nz/posts.php?topic=101943
Repo: http://sourceforge.net/projects/indevide/

GEdit plugin
Topic: http://mojolabs.nz/posts.php?topic=87684
Site: http://chaos-interactive.de/en/geditbmax

Geany plugin
Topic: http://mojolabs.nz/posts.php?topic=98327